The Genius Computer Technology SP-HF280 2-way loudspeaker delivers a compact wired audio solution with a rated RMS power of 6 W. Designed for universal desktop and small-room use, this brown speaker offers two audio output channels and a frequency response spanning 100–20,000 Hz, providing clear reproduction of vocals and mid-to-high frequencies. With a nominal impedance of 4 ohms and a lightweight build, the SP-HF280 is suitable for integration into basic PC and multimedia setups.
The two-way design separates drivers to improve midrange and treble clarity while the 6 W RMS power ensures consistent low to moderate volume playback. Wired connectivity provides a stable audio connection without latency or pairing requirements. The compact, lightweight enclosure simplifies placement on desks, shelves or near monitors, and the neutral brown finish blends with a variety of interiors and workspaces.
Connect the SP-HF280 to the audio output of your computer, laptop or compatible audio source using the wired connector. Place the speaker on a stable surface at ear level for optimal clarity, and position it so that the front face is unobstructed. Start playback at a low volume and adjust gradually to the desired listening level. For stereo reproduction, ensure the speaker is paired properly with its counterpart and positioned symmetrically relative to the listening position.
To maintain sound quality, avoid placing the speaker directly against soft fabrics or enclosed spaces that could muffle the drivers. Keep liquid and dust away from the speaker and allow for ventilation. Use moderate volume levels to prevent distortion and prolong driver life.
